// Given an Async Function (Not a promise) this class will ensure that the run method can only run 1 instance of that async operation at a time. | |
class AsyncSingleInstance { | |
// Soon we will have private fields? https://github.com/tc39/proposal-class-fields#private-fields | |
//#inProgress; | |
//#asyncFunction; | |
constructor(asyncFunction) { | |
this.inProgress = false; | |
this.asyncFunction = asyncFunction; | |
} | |
get isRunning() { | |
return this.inProgress; | |
} | |
// Ensures only one instance of the asyncFunction will run at once, will return a promise that resolves to the result or errors if already in use. | |
async run() { | |
if (this.inProgress) { | |
throw new Error('Task '+this.asyncFunction.name+' is already in progress.'); | |
} | |
this.inProgress = true; | |
try { | |
var result = await this.asyncFunction(...arguments); | |
// Ensure we are not in progress anymore. | |
this.inProgress = false; | |
return result; | |
} catch(e) { | |
// Ensure we are not in progress anymore. | |
this.inProgress = false; | |
throw e; | |
} | |
} | |
} | |
module.exports = AsyncSingleInstance; |

// Useful for mocking a long to run async process. | |
function delay(ms, result) { | |
return new Promise(function(resolve, reject) { | |
setTimeout(function() { | |
resolve(result); | |
}, ms); | |
}); | |
} | |
function delayError(ms, error) { | |
return new Promise(function(resolve, reject) { | |
setTimeout(function() { | |
reject(error); | |
}, ms); | |
}); | |
} | |
module.exports.delay = delay; | |
module.exports.delayError = delayError; |

async function Disposable(delegate, action, argArray = [], disposer = "dispose") { | |
var disposable = await Promise.resolve(delegate()); | |
try { | |
var results = await action(disposable, ... argArray); | |
} finally { | |
if (typeof disposer === 'string' || disposer instanceof String) { | |
if (disposable[disposer] instanceof Function) { | |
await Promise.resolve(disposable[disposer]()); | |
} | |
} else if (disposer instanceof Function) { | |
await Promise.resolve(disposer(disposable)); | |
} | |
} | |
return results; | |
} | |
module.exports = Disposable; |
